Hi Phil... No this is not the situation. Our application is a combination of servlet and jsp pages which uses a bean interface to talk to a separate proprietary server.
Lisa -----Original Message----- From: Phillip Morelock [mailto:[EMAIL PROTECTED]] Sent: Tuesday, May 28, 2002 5:06 PM To: Tomcat Users List Subject: Re: Out of Memory Errors. Help! are you using a database by chance? most likely culprit is a badly garbage-collected partly-native database driver. If you are using the JDBC ODBC bridge driver, you're definitely having problems. If by chance (just guessing at this point) you're using MS SQL Server 2k, use microsoft's JDBC driver instead. fillup On 5/28/02 2:04 PM, "Mc Cabe, Lisa" <[EMAIL PROTECTED]> wrote: > > Hi... Hope there is someone out there who can help with this! > > We are attempting to connect 50 clients to Tomcat 4.03 (running stand-alone) > simultaneously. > After several minutes, we get the error java.lang.OutOfMemoryError and all > threads terminate, however it would appear that we have plenty of memory. > > The java.exe memory goes to about 90 mg when the error occurs. > > The machine is: Windows 2000 512 mg. > > > Our CATALINA_OPTS setting is: -Xms128m -Xmx256m. We tried bumping this up to > no avail. > > > This our HTTP connector setting in the server.xml file: > > <!-- Define a non-SSL HTTP/1.1 Connector on port 8080 --> > <Connector className="org.apache.catalina.connector.http.HttpConnector" > port="8080" minProcessors="5" maxProcessors="250" > enableLookups="true" redirectPort="8443" > acceptCount="10" debug="0" connectionTimeout="60000"/> > > THis is the stack trace in the localhost_log.2002-05-28.txt > > 2002-05-28 15:58:35 StandardWrapperValve[CubeServlet]: Servlet.service() for > servlet CubeServlet threw exception > javax.servlet.ServletException: Servlet execution threw an exception > at > org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Fi > lterChain.java:269) > at > org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Chai > n.java:193) > at > org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java > :243) > at > org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566> ) > at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472) > at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943) > at > org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java > :190) > at > org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566> ) > at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472) > at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943) > at org.apache.catalina.core.StandardContext.invoke(StandardContext.java:2343) > at > org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:180) > at > org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566> ) > at > org.apache.catalina.valves.ErrorDispatcherValve.invoke(ErrorDispatcherValve.ja > va:170) > at > org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:564> ) > at > org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:170) > at > org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:564> ) > at org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:468) > at > org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:564> ) > at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472) > at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943) > at > org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:1 > 74) > at > org.apache.catalina.core.StandardPipeline.invokeNext(StandardPipeline.java:566> ) > at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:472) > at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:943) > at > org.apache.catalina.connector.http.HttpProcessor.process(HttpProcessor.java:10 > 12) > at > org.apache.catalina.connector.http.HttpProcessor.run(HttpProcessor.java:1107) > at java.lang.Thread.run(Unknown Source) > ----- Root Cause ----- > java.lang.OutOfMemoryError > <<no stack trace available>> > > -- > To unsubscribe, e-mail: <mailto:[EMAIL PROTECTED]> > For additional commands, e-mail: <mailto:[EMAIL PROTECTED]> > -- To unsubscribe, e-mail: <mailto:[EMAIL PROTECTED]> For additional commands, e-mail: <mailto:[EMAIL PROTECTED]> -- To unsubscribe, e-mail: <mailto:[EMAIL PROTECTED]> For additional commands, e-mail: <mailto:[EMAIL PROTECTED]>